About this grant

This general purposes grant will focus on strengthening the Center for Socio-Environmental Support’s administrative, operational, and resource mobilization capacity over the next two years. The Center for Socio-Environmental Support is a Brazilian grantmaking and capacity building organization founded by a group of non-governmental organizations. Its mission is to provide both technical and financial support for the work of community organizations and non-governmental organizations throughout Brazil and neighboring countries. It supports organizations that monitor environmentally damaging projects in their communities; develop strategies to expand sustainable development options for local communities, particularly new energy alternatives; and work to reform policies and practices of international financial institutions. Over the next two years, the grantee will solidify its grantmaking, advisory, and operational structures; establish proper administrative and accountability mechanisms; and mobilize local financial and technical resources from Brazil and other neighboring countries for regranting and capacity building.
